Where to Buy Discounted Gift Cards
Here are some of the best places to find gift cards at a discount:
- Costco: Available in-store and online, Costco offers gift cards for popular retailers and restaurants. Executive members enjoy an extra 2% off, making it a great option for bulk savings.
- Best Buy & Staples: Keep an eye out for occasional sales on gift cards for electronics, dining, and more. These are perfect for tech enthusiasts or office supplies.
- Grocery Stores (e.g., Publix): Many supermarkets run weekly promotions on gift cards. Check your local store’s flyer or app for deals on brands like Amazon or Starbucks.
- Office Depot & Staples: These stores frequently offer deals on Visa and Mastercard gift cards, which are versatile for any purchase. Pair with the right credit card for maximum rewards (more on that below).

Top Apps and Programs for Gift Card Deals
Apps and membership programs make it easier than ever to access discounted gift cards instantly. Here are the best options:
- Pepper App: This app lets you generate gift cards instantly for hundreds of brands, including Walmart, Amazon, and Macy’s. Look for daily deals with discounts up to 15% or more, plus earn coins two weeks after purchase to redeem for future gift cards.
- Fluz: A unique platform hosting weekly “parties” where group purchases unlock bigger discounts. It’s a bit complex but rewarding for savvy users.
- eGifter & MyGiftCardPlus (MGCP): These platforms offer monthly sales, typically on the 1st and 15th, for popular brands like Target and Home Depot.
- AARP (Paid Membership): AARP members get access to daily deals with 20%+ off on limited-quantity gift cards, plus year-round discounts (e.g., 5% off Airbnb or Princess Cruises).
Supercharge Savings with Credit Card Offers
Using the right credit card can amplify your gift card savings. Here’s how:
- Amex Business Gold: Offers a $20 monthly credit and 4x points on purchases at Office Depot/Staples, perfect for Visa/Mastercard gift cards.
- Chase Ink Business Cash: Earn 5x points on office supply store purchases, including gift cards.
- Chase Ink Preferred: Get 3x points on Pepper app purchases for travel or online gift cards.
- Amex Offers: Look for deals like $20 off $100 at Lowe’s. Buy a Visa gift card to save after activation fees. One reader saved thousands on a home renovation by stacking Home Depot gift cards at 10%+ off!
Caution: Always check gift card terms, as they’re typically non-refundable, and some products may not be eligible.
Real-World Example: Saving at Macy’s with Pepper
Imagine you’re at Macy’s, trying on a $300 suit you love, but the price gives you pause. Before heading to the register, open the Pepper app and discover Macy’s gift cards at 15% off, generated instantly. That’s an immediate $45 savings! Pay with a Chase Ink Preferred (3x points) or Amex Business Gold (4x points) to earn rewards on top. For even smarter shopping, check Pepper or DoctorOfCredit.com before your trip to plan your discount. Remember: Gift cards are non-refundable, so ensure you’re set on the purchase!
Tips for Success
To make the most of discounted gift cards, keep these in mind:
- Plan Ahead: Since most gift cards are non-refundable, only buy for purchases you’re certain about.
- Check Eligibility: Some products (e.g., certain electronics or services) may not be purchasable with gift cards—read the fine print.
